Transaction 897544453e24c3230e019d7a17d2fb2c59a9962b8496f5c118c74b29af4122e7
1 Input
1 Output
-
897544453e24c3230e019d7a17d2fb2c59a9962b8496f5c118c74b29af4122e7:0
- value
- 31670217
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 06314ab3afbef826afb1c98a76d9d72bce39b1a1 OP_EQUAL
- address
- 32Fm2YpEdBhGgGpKFY3V2ZUfmoQobyvvAC